  • Hawaiki Submarine Cable contracted Ciena to upgrade the capacity of its recently launched subsea cable connecting New Zealand and Australia with the west coast of the US.

    The company selected Ciena's GoMesh Extreme solution to increase the cable's total capacity by 53% to 67Tbps, up from the design capacity of 43.8Tbps at the time of its launch in July.

  • Thailand's National Broadcasting and Telecommunications Commission (NBTC) will take its second attempt at auctioning 5 MHz of 900-MHz spectrum during an auction now scheduled for October 20.

    The regulator has given prospective bidders until October 8 to submit bid documents for the auction, and plans to name the qualified bidders on October 17, the Bangkok Post reported.
